Signalling Connection Control Part (SCCP)
Description: OpenSS7 Product Status SS7 Stack SCCP
Note that it is now possible to select from most of these categories off of the
"Related" sidebar menu.
|
Overview:- |
This is the Signalling System No. 7 (SS7) Signalling Connection Control Part (SCCP) component of
the OpenSS7 stack. This component implements the SCCP functions in a STREAMS multiplexing
driver.
The SCCP STREAMS driver provides three user-level interfaces: the Signalling Connection Control
Part Interface (SCCPI), the Network Provider Interface (NPI) and the Transport Provider
Interface (TPI).
An additional Global Title Interface (GTT) is provided to allow for Global Title Translation
(GTT) under the control of a user level process or a specialized GTT module pushed on a GTT
stream.
The SCCP STREAMS driver supports I_LINK and I_PLINK of Message Transfer Part Interface (MTPI)
streams providing SS7 MTP Level 3 MTP-SAPs under the multiplexing driver.
The SCCP STREAMS driver supports all SCCP protocol classes and options including connectionless
and connection-oriented. It supports a wide range of International and National protocol
variants.
|
|
History:- |
The SCCP component was started in 1996. Current STREAMS based approaches were started in
January 2000.
|
|
Status:- |
The SCCP component of the OpenSS7 stack is in the Testing stage.
|
|
Dependencies:- |
This component depends on the SS7 MTP Level 3, SIGTRAN M3UA or TALI drivers and the Message Transfer Part
Interface (MTPI).
|
|
Design:- |
Designs for the SCCP component will be available here.
|
|
Documentation:- |
Documentation has not yet been publicly released. Documentation for the SCCP component will be
available here.
The following preliminary manual pages will be available: sccp(4), SCCP driver manpage; sccpi(7), SCCPI interface manpage; npi_sccp(7), SCCP NPI interface manpage; tpi_sccp(7), SCCP TPI interface manpage; xti_sccp(3), SCCP XTI interface manpage; sccp_socket(7), SCCP SOCKETS interface manpage; sccp_ioctl(4), SCCP IO Controls; sccp(8), SCCP Administration.
|
|
Test Results:- |
Test results have not yet been released to the public. SCCP test results will be publicly
released with the next major release of the strss7 package.
Preliminary PICS and PIXIT Proforma for SCCP will be available here.
|
|
References:- |
A reference list for the SCCP can be viewed here.
|
|
Code:- |
Code has not yet been released to the public. Source code is available on the OpenSS7 CVS
archive under the subdirectory /strss7/src/modules/sccp.
The SCCP component code will be publicly released with the next major release of the
strss7 package.
|
|
Release Package:- |
The Signalling Connection Control Part (SCCP) is an integral part of the OpenSS7 STREAMS SS7
stack and can be found in the sccp sub-directory in the
strss release code. Please see the Downloads Page for more
information.
|
|